Skip to content

Latest commit

 

History

History
90 lines (64 loc) · 2.83 KB

Vim.md

File metadata and controls

90 lines (64 loc) · 2.83 KB

Vim编辑器总结


一、日常发现总结(持续更新)

  • 日常开发中,知道某一行有错,打开文件的时候同时定位到对应的行。命令: vim 文件名 +行数
  • 如果后面没有加上函数,也就是vim 文件名 +,则定位到文件末尾;
  • 如果在终端强制退出vim,会产生一个.swp的交换文件,再次编辑的时候会出现需要选择编辑的情况,此时选择D选项,删除之前的.swp文件,然后编辑即可;
  • "+y将Vim中的内容复制到系统剪切板;
  • "+p将系统剪切板的内容拷贝到vim中(非编辑模式下)。

二、基本知识总结

1、工作模式

1565964389885

1565964401993

注意末行模式的常见命令:

1565964419977

1565964463324

1565964519436

2、移动、选中文本(可视化)

1565964550546

1565964571182

3、撤销、恢复、删除

1565964583608

4、复制、粘贴、替换

1565964660005

5、 缩排、重复执行

1565964689620

6、查找、替换

1565964701388

7、查找、替换

1565964718679

1565964762783

替换结果:

1565964782977

8、插入命令的扩展

1565964805843

插入命令的两个日常使用

1565964820606

9、分屏命令

1565964856379

Vim默认的内置文件浏览器

在这里插入图片描述

1565964882432

展示一个为目录,一个来编辑文件。

1565964898514


三、命令表

1、移动光标

1565964919850

1565964931958

2、搜寻与取代

1565964942539

3、删除、复制、粘贴

1565964957118 1565964968950

4、插入模式

1565964982096

5、末行模式命令

1565964998863

6、区块选择、分屏

1565965012509 在这里插入图片描述